Mark your calendars for the 4th annual TASTE OF THE TOWN food truck and dessert rally at Hopkinsville Brewing Company! Every Eighth of August weekend, we celebrate freedom, food and family. Similar to Juneteenth, Eighth of August is when enslaved people in Kentucky received the news that the Emancipation Proclamation had been signed. To celebrate,…

On Monday, August 19, the final Museum Monday of the summer will be OUT OF THIS WORLD as we talk All About Aliens! On August 21, 1955, strange visitors dropped in on a family in Kelly, Kentucky. Come learn about this interesting story that helped give birth to the “Little Green Men” phenomenon worldwide!The Museums…
